Universities near Door 12 J. Abad Santos Street, Davao City, Philippines - Page 3
Showing 21 - 21 of 21
University of Southeastern Philippines
UniversitiesApproximately 1.92 KM away
Address : Porras Street, Obrero, Davao City, Davao del Sur, Philippines